Genesis10 is seeking a Strategic Sourcing Manager for a 6-month contract position with our healthcare services client. The position is 100% remote.
Compensation: $50.00 - $55.00 per hour (W-2). The Strategic Sourcing Manager is responsible for partnering with specific business units to manage their sourcing needs. This includes the development of a vendor strategy, designing and administering RFXs, negotiations, contracting, and other sourcing management functions. This position also leads mid-sized department projects and initiatives, as well as assists in the development of the client's Strategic Sourcing strategy. Responsibilities: * Set the category sourcing strategy and leverage all spend to manage the category's total costs while enhancing vendor services to meet the category's ever-evolving needs * Work directly with our client's business partners and Strategic Sourcing Leadership to refine the sourcing strategy to address and meet the ever-changing needs and requirements * Initiate, direct and conduct all activities relating to evaluating, selecting, negotiating, and implementing preferred supplier contracts and develop and maintain long-term relationships with our clients' strategic suppliers * Negotiate and manage the contracting process for business partners, ensuring that terms are consistent with Prime's standards and that renewals, amendments, and terminations are managed in a timely manner Requirements * Bachelor's degree in accounting, finance, supply chain or related area of study, or equivalent combination of education and/or work experience * 5 years of strategic sourcing, vendor management, procurement, or similar experience * Must be eligible to work in the United States without the need for a work visa or residency sponsorship * Prior project management experience requiring collaboration and coordination across multiple business areas and stakeholder groups * Strong verbal and written communication skills * Ability to work effectively in a matrix environment, collaborate, and manage multiple tasks and priorities * Advanced proficiency in the Microsoft Office suite * PBM/health care experience * Experience sourcing one or more of the following categories: facilities, marketing, human resources, clinical, customer service, or PBM operations * Familiarity with vendor contracting requirements in the healthcare industry (e.g., HIPAA, accreditation agencies, etc.) If you have the described qualifications and are interested in this exciting opportunity, apply today!
